The Boston Red Sox travel to face the Kansas City Royals on Wednesday May 20, 2026, at Kauffman Stadium in Kansas City, Missouri. First pitch is scheduled for 7:40 PM ET with television coverage on MLB.TV. At the time of this writing the odds were not released. Be sure to check out our free MLB picks.

Starting Pitchers

Connelly Early is expected to start for Boston in this matchup. The left-hander enters with a 3-2 record, a 3.21 ERA, and a 1.20 WHIP across 47.2 innings pitched. He has allowed 39 hits while recording 45 strikeouts and issuing 18 walks with seven home runs surrendered. Kansas City is expected to counter with Michael Wacha, who enters with a 4-2 record, a 2.83 ERA, and a 0.99 WHIP over 57.1 innings. He has allowed 39 hits while striking out 47 batters and walking 18 while allowing seven home runs.

Boston Hoping to Build on Series Opening Victory

The Red Sox enter Wednesday with a 20-27 overall record and a 12-13 road record. Boston recently won over Kansas City 3-1 after recently losing to Atlanta 8-1 and 3-2 in 10 innings. The Red Sox also recently won over Atlanta 3-2 before recently losing to Philadelphia 3-1. Boston has played several close games recently and will look to build momentum after the strong pitching performance in the series opener.

Boston is batting .235 as a team with 170 runs scored and 369 hits this season. The Red Sox have hit 34 home runs while posting a .310 on-base percentage and a .357 slugging percentage. On the mound, Boston owns a 3.75 ERA and a 1.24 WHIP while opponents are batting .236 against the pitching staff. The Red Sox have also recorded 383 strikeouts while issuing 148 walks this season.

One key strength for Boston entering this matchup is pitching consistency. The Red Sox carry the lower ERA, lower WHIP, and better opponent batting average compared to Kansas City. Boston also held the Royals to one run in the previous meeting and has allowed three runs or fewer in three of its last five games.

Royals Looking for More Offensive Production

Kansas City enters Wednesday with a 20-28 overall record and a 13-11 home record. The Royals recently lost to Boston 3-1 after recently winning over St. Louis 2-0. Kansas City also recently lost to St. Louis by scores of 4-2 and 5-4 in 11 innings while recently losing to the White Sox 6-2. The Royals have struggled offensively during this stretch, scoring two runs or fewer in three of their last five games.

Kansas City is batting .238 as a team with 190 runs scored and 378 hits this season. The Royals have hit 46 home runs while posting a .316 on-base percentage and a .384 slugging percentage. On the mound, Kansas City owns a 4.26 ERA and a 1.36 WHIP while opponents are batting .239 against the pitching staff. The Royals have issued 202 walks and recorded 400 strikeouts this season.

One positive for Kansas City is power production. The Royals hold the edge in home runs, runs scored, and slugging percentage entering this matchup. However, Kansas City’s pitching staff has struggled more consistently than Boston’s, and the offense has cooled recently after being limited to one run in the series opener.

Boston Red Sox vs Kansas City Royals Picks and Prediction

Boston Red Sox vs Kansas City Royals Pick

  • Pick: Boston Red Sox Moneyline

Boston enters this matchup with the advantage in overall pitching numbers and recently defeated Kansas City 3-1 in the series opener. The Red Sox hold the lower ERA, WHIP, and opponent batting average while also sending a starter to the mound with a strong 3.21 ERA. Kansas City has struggled offensively during the past week, and Boston’s ability to limit scoring recently gives the Red Sox the edge entering Wednesday.

Boston Red Sox vs Kansas City Royals Total Pick

  • Pick: Take the under if the total is set at 8

I would lean toward the under because both starting pitchers enter with ERA numbers near or below 3.20 and both teams have played several lower-scoring games recently. Boston recently won the opener 3-1, while Kansas City has scored two runs or fewer in three of its last five games. Boston’s pitching staff has also consistently limited opponents this season with a 3.75 ERA and a .236 opponent batting average. This matchup profiles as another controlled scoring game.

Final Score Prediction: Boston Red Sox 4 – Kansas City Royals 2
